Course content
|
1. Critical points in solving word problems. 2. Mathematical competitions at primary and secondary school. 3. Types of proof, teaching proof and its place in secondary school mathematics. 4. Possibilities of using computer technology and various online environments in mathematics education. 5. Probability and statistics in secondary school. 6. Development of logical thinking. 7. Developing functional thinking 8. Platonic solids - spatial imagination in a slightly different way. 9. Motivational environments and motivational tasks in mathematics education. 10. The theory of didactic situations. 11. Van Hiele's model of concept formation, vertical and horizontal thinking. 12. Significant problems of building mathematics in historical context in the language of primary and secondary school.

Learning outcomes
|
To acquaint students with modern and non-traditional methods of teaching mathematics - the use of information technology, creating didactic situations, working in a motivational environment. Working with gifted pupils, using educational centers, creating innovative teaching materials.
